Gate evidence pack — G1–G5

Assembled 2026-08-19 at engine 8e0af26. This pack leads with what it does NOT prove, on purpose: the recurring failure mode across this build was a selected number becoming the headline, and every instance was caught only by looking. A pack that names its limits first cannot be read as overclaiming — and it is the version that survives a bank's security review rather than merely passing ours. Numbers reproduce from the committed gold + the local corpus (mirrored to the private bucket).

Bounds and honest limitations (read first)

  • G3 real-event volume is DEFERRED to real-customer data (project decision, 2026-08-19). 438 real delegation events against a 2,000 target; the normalized-dataset target (≥10,000) is met at 18,450. The 2,000 was always a proxy for corpus richness bought from ourselves; the flywheel (customer-exported bundles, never background telemetry) supplies real volume once a design partner runs the loop. "Deferred to real-customer data", not "not met". The 25%-non-code G3 amendment is parked with it.
  • Customer-domain enforcement is now shown on three frameworks (A3); customer-domain observe-sampling is ADK-only. customer-service + financial-advisor were observed/scored on ADK; CrewAI and LangGraph are additionally enforced live on a customer-domain (travel-booking) workload — real delegation, a held payments.transfer denied live, offline-verifiable, no divergence (docs/A3-FRAMEWORKS.md). Bound that remains: those two are configured crews/graphs, not scraped third-party apps (crewAI-examples target an old API; LangGraph apps are heterogeneous) — a real third-party customer-domain app on a non-ADK framework is a design-partner activity. G1/G5 derivation-quality numbers remain ADK-observed.
  • The G1 hold-out over-provision metric rests on 13 clean rows. The express hold-out has 43 rows but only 13 survive the truncated/degenerate exclusion; the unused-scope and over-provision figures are computed on those 13. Small sample.
  • The finance-advisory pack was curated from the very traces it is scored on. financial-advisor shows 100% curated because we wrote its pack from its own tool set — that is onboarding, not a blind test. The honest out-of-sample curation number is customer-service (0% → 100% after curation) and the day-0 coverage on datasets the catalog never saw (§G5, and the BFCL/hermes/ToolACE out-of-sample numbers).
  • No live payment denial. Enforce is proven live single-agent and across a chain, but the specific "a booking agent's process_payment is denied live" run was not done (21-agent app, low marginal value). The deriver holding process_payment until --grant payments.transfer is pinned offline (tests/test_onboarding.py), not shown live.
  • L3 (the LLM proposer) was never built. Its trigger — a domain whose day-0 path cannot produce a confident curated grant — was never met: on the two customer domains measured, L2 (catalog + curation) resolved everything. The architectural finding (templates are a code-agent artifact; the catalog generalises) is settled; L3 stays deferred until a real gap appears.
  • All sampling is Haiku-class except the two live Sonnet enforce runs. Ceilings derived from Haiku over-exploration may be looser than a frontier model needs (a small frontier calibration slice is planned).
  • The onboarding wall-clock was measured by the builder, not a naive operator. The ≤1h / ~minutes figure (G4/G5) inherits expert bias: I knew the vocabulary and the tools. A genuinely naive onboarding — the true G4 number — is a design-partner activity that solo work cannot manufacture. The judgement points are real; the time is a floor, not a representative user's.

G1 — derivation works

Hold-out (project-level, express held out; 13 clean rows), chain scoring: benign-deny 0.0 · unused-scope 5.8% · over-provision 3 · escalation 0 (thresholds ≤2% / ≤20% / esc 0). python -m attenu_derive.eval.g1 --holdout express --check

G2 — protects real projects

  • Enforce (offline, 21 projects incl. 2 ADK customer-domain): 0 benign blocks; 32 role-violation over-reaches correctly blocked. python -m attenu_derive.eval.enforce --all
  • Adversarial over-reach: 8,783 / 8,783 = 100%, scope-class 100%, 0 misses. python -m attenu_derive.eval.adversarial --all
  • Task-string injection: 43,128 poisoned variants, 0 widened, 0 escalations (24 correctly narrower). python -m attenu_derive.eval.injection --all
  • Live, single agent (Haiku + Sonnet): a real customer-service agent denied mid-run on a held scope; denial contract observed; ledger anchored. docs/LIVE-ENFORCE.md.
  • Live, delegation chain (Haiku): analyst {web.fetch} ⊂ coordinator, denied web.search mid-chain; ledger anchored across the chain. docs/LIVE-ENFORCE.md (chain section).
  • Structural, not model-dependent: Haiku ≡ Sonnet — enforcement does not inherit the model's judgment. (Bound: both are ADK.)

G3 — data flywheel

  • Real corpus: 438 delegation events / 599 rows / 21 projects × 4 frameworks. The ≥2,000 real-event target is DEFERRED to real-customer data (project decision, 2026-08-19): 2,000 bought from ourselves was a proxy; real volume arrives via the flywheel — customer-initiated evidence-bundle export, never background telemetry (the custody story is the thing a bank buys). The 25%-non-code amendment is parked with it.
  • Normalized datasets: 18,450 rows (BFCL + hermes + ToolACE; target ≥ 10,000 — MET).
  • Versioned corpus + eval harness gate every release in CI (G1 + adversarial + injection gates + corpus lint). MET.

G4 — production grade

  • Onboard in ≤ 1 hour: MET — travel-concierge to 100% curated in minutes following docs/ONBOARDING.md.
  • Threat model, denial contract, strike policy, ledger anchoring (ADR-14): filed and tested.
  • Packaging (Phase A1): installable wheel + attenu CLI (onboard/coverage/verify) — installs into a clean env with no source tree; onboarding re-measured through the packaged path at ~1s (docs/OPS-RUNBOOK.md).
  • Internal security review vs the 5 threat-model invariants: all pass, 2 trust-boundary concerns with mitigations + Phase-B/C actions, labelled internal (docs/SECURITY-REVIEW.md). External review is Phase C.
  • Perf: Deriver.propose p50 0.038 ms / p95 0.074 ms / max 0.178 ms over real events (budget <50 ms); model path N/A (L3 never built).
  • Ledger contract for the console (2026-08-19, slice 1 / Plan A): held ≠ denied is now ON the ledger (disposition on every deny, in the model-facing denial, across all 12 adapters); products have an identity before a key (attenu init.attenu/product.json, per-process boot id, assigned chain ids); the spool sink carries the ingest idempotency key; inside a product the anchor is signed with a product-local Ed25519 key and verified with the public key only (attenu verify --pubkey) — the HMAC test signer survives only outside a product and is labelled attenu-anchor-TEST. Repro: shim python tests/test_core_v02.py, python tests/test_sinks_identity.py, python tests/test_adapters_contract.py; engine python -m pytest -q tests/test_disposition.py tests/test_product.py tests/test_run_adk_enforce.py tests/test_cli.py.
  • Delegation-graph UI and service mode live in the optional Attenu console (https://attenu.io): the graph with denials by disposition and the verified mark (integrity · monotonicity · containment against the product's public key), evidence download, and Decisions. The open engine needs none of it; attenu demo produces a real anchored ledger with no model and no key.
  • Control with integrity (2026-08-19, slice 2): every change to what a product may do (grants, declared tools, policy) is a signed config revision — hashed, parent-chained, verified before a runner applies it, refused beyond the product's ceiling and on conflict (last-known-good stays); the cloud's revisions are signed by the Attenu signer the engine trusts offline; attenu config / attenu ceiling; the console shows "what I decided and what changed" with diffs and signatures. Custody options: product-local Ed25519 key (default) or KMS (attenu init --anchor kms; ES256; the key never leaves the HSM; auditors verify with ECDSAP256Verifier, no cloud SDK) — stub-tested until an AWS account exists. Out-of-band anchoring (AnchorScheduler) for long-running apps. Evidence report (attenu report, the console's Report button): a printable page rendered from the bundle + verification — the three checks, the anchor key, the chain as tree + table, denials in plain words, how to re-verify. Demo depth: attenu demo --scenario fanout (9 agents / 18 tools / every disposition / a strike revocation) and the real 21-agent travel-concierge run live as a 3-level chain. Two real bugs found by the richer app and fixed RED→GREEN (ADK transfer-back treated as a delegation; the enforce runner's sub-agent requests lacking their own descendants). G4: what remains for "production grade" is a hosted deployment and the slice-3 surface.

G5 — day-0 story

A brand-new app held out of all training (travel-concierge) gets safe derivation from the shipped kit alone: all payment tools withheld, unknowns fail-closed, reads granted heuristically — shadow-ready with zero unintended-payment risk. Curation then takes it to 100% with money tools held pending an operator grant. docs/ONBOARDING.md; tests/test_onboarding.py. Out-of-sample catalog coverage on public datasets the catalog never saw is the corroborating number (BFCL/hermes/ToolACE, catalog.coverage).

Operating cost (measured, A2c): across the 3 onboarded apps, 23 tools, 7 (30%) required an operator judgement call, 70% mechanical scaffold confirmations. The judgement calls are front-loaded on the tier-2 tools a bank wants a human deciding (payments, mail held requires_grant), so the curation burden scales with an app's distinct sensitive tools, not its traffic, and day-0 is safe before any of it. Pinned ≤50% by a test (tests/test_onboarding.py).
